In 2019, the travel and tourism industry generated nearly $9 trillion, or 10.4 percent of the world's GDP, and the sector employed 330 million people, or one in 10 jobs globally. Based on a sample of 179 hospitality students who were working in the industry, the study showed that racial discrimination is prevalent in the hospitality industry such that people of color suffer from a higher level of discrimination than Whites people. Implicit Racial Bias is Malleable but Stable in Young Adults Lab interventions in young adults can reduce implicit racial bias, but only for hours to days immediately afterward, and do not change explicit racial bias or prejudice Reviewed by Introduction Recent research on implicit social cognition suggests that implicit associations may be malleable to change.
